Improving the prediction of metastatic disease in primary colorectal cancer

Improving the prediction of metastatic disease in primary colorectal cancer: prospective multicentre evaluation of a prognostic model of conventional predictive variables and novel variables derived from perfusion computed tomography

Conditions

Colorectal cancer Cancer Malignant neoplasm of rectosigmoid junction

Interventions

1. Perfusion computed tomography (CT) sequence 2. An additional perfusion CT sequence during the standard contrast-enhanced staging CT 3. Follow Up Length: 36 months

Inclusion criteria

Inclusion criteria: 1. Patients with suspected or proven (via optical colonoscopy and biopsy) colorectal cancer attending for pre-operative staging CT 2. Suspicion of colorectal cancer defined as: 2.1. Presence of a mass highly suspicious for colorectal cancer on barium enema, CT colonography or other imaging 2.2. Large bowel obstruction 2.3. Elevated serum CEA 3. Ability to provide informed written consent 4. Aged 18 years or over 5. Male or female participants

Exclusion criteria

Exclusion criteria: 1. Inability to provide informed written consent 2. Pregnancy 3. Renal impairment defined as serum creatinine >1150mmol/L 4. Previous iodinated contrast allergy 5. Inability to cannulate 6. Inability to lie flat 7. Weight greater than 200 kg (maximum weight capacity of CT scanner is 200 kg)

Design outcomes

Primary

MeasureTime frame
1. To improve the prediction of metastatic disease in patients with colorectal cancer by developing a prognostic model based on disease-free survival 2. Measured at 3 and 5 years for each individual patient
